SAG-AFTRA ratifies TV animation contracts that establish AI protections for voice actors

None None

SAG-AFTRA announced on Friday night that its members approved new three-year contracts for voice actors working in TV animation. The contracts define voice actor as a term that "only includes humans" and set protections around AI, along with wage increases.
